#fe469e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e469e is composed of 99.6% red, 27.5%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 331.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 63.5%. #fe469e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#fd003d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#fe469e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fe469e has RGB values of R:254, G:70,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.38, K:0. Its decimal value is 16664222.

Hex triplet fe469e #fe469e
RGB Decimal 254, 70, 158 rgb(254,70,158)
RGB Percent 99.6, 27.5, 62 rgb(99.6%,27.5%,62%)
CMYK 0, 72, 38, 0
HSL 331.3°, 98.9, 63.5 hsl(331.3,98.9%,63.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 331.3°, 72.4, 99.6
Web Safe ff3399 #ff3399
CIE-LAB 59.821, 74.748, -6.465
XYZ 49.236, 27.925, 35.143
xyY 0.438, 0.249, 27.925
CIE-LCH 59.821, 75.027, 355.057
CIE-LUV 59.821, 113.186, -23.438
Hunter-Lab 52.844, 73.836, -2.44
Binary 11111110, 01000110, 10011110

Shades and Tints of #fe469e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0005 is the darkest color, while #fff6fa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fe469e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#878787 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9f7a8c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8594c8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a39195 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f96065 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b177b9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c47698 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fb567a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
